The History of Boudoir Photography
Boudoir photography has its roots in the early 20th century when photographers began experimenting with capturing intimate portraits in private settings. The term "boudoir" originates from the French word for a private room or bedroom, where women would prepare for social events. Initially, these photographs were reserved for the elite and served as a way to document personal beauty and elegance.
Over time, boudoir photography evolved into a more accessible and inclusive art form. Today, it encompasses a wide range of styles and themes, catering to diverse audiences. The rise of social media platforms has further popularized boudoir photography, allowing photographers and models to share their work with a global audience.

Essential Equipment for Boudoir Photography
Having the right equipment is vital for capturing high-quality boudoir images. A good camera, lenses, and lighting equipment form the foundation of any successful boudoir photography setup. While professional-grade equipment is ideal, many photographers achieve stunning results with entry-level gear and creative techniques.
Invest in lenses that offer versatility and sharpness, such as prime lenses with wide apertures for creating beautiful bokeh effects. Lighting plays a crucial role in boudoir photography, so consider using softbox lights, ring lights, or natural light to achieve the desired look.

Understanding Lighting in Boudoir Photography
Lighting is one of the most important aspects of boudoir photography, influencing the mood and overall quality of the images. Mastering lighting techniques can elevate your photographs from ordinary to extraordinary. Experiment with different lighting setups, such as side lighting, backlighting, and rim lighting, to create depth and dimension in your images.
Natural light is often preferred for boudoir photography due to its soft and flattering qualities. However, artificial lighting can be used effectively to create specific effects and moods. Understanding how light interacts with the subject and environment is essential for achieving professional results.

Editing Techniques for Boudoir Photos
Post-processing plays a significant role in enhancing boudoir photographs, bringing out the best in each image. Editing software such as Adobe Lightroom and Photoshop offer powerful tools for color correction, skin retouching, and creative enhancements. However, it's important to maintain a natural look and avoid over-editing, which can detract from the authenticity of the images.
Focus on enhancing the subject's features while preserving their natural beauty. Techniques such as dodge and burn, color grading, and sharpening can add depth and polish to your photographs. Remember to respect the client's preferences and maintain professional standards during the editing process.
